On the first episode of The Nostalgia Trap, I sit down to a conversation with writer and editor Connor Kilpatrick of Jacobin magazine. Connor and I talk about his childhood in Texas, his surprisingly apolitical college years, and the "moment of clarity" after Obama's election that led him to the optimistic brand of left politics he embraces today.
